On the 20th April, 2026 BSE Index Services has launched the BSE Housing Finance Index. This new index is designed to track the performance of companies which are operating in the housing finance segment. As the country’s real estate and home loan markets continue to expand this sector-specific index aims to provide the investors with the focused benchmark and will enhance the participation in the growing housing finance ecosystem.
BSE Housing Finance Index: Key Highlights
This newly introduced index is a sectoral index which captures the performance of the housing finance companies which are listed within the broader market.
It has been constructed using the stocks from the BSE 1000 Index and specifically those which are classified under the housing finance segment.

Rebalancing and Structure of the Index
The BSE Housing Finance Index will be reconstituted twice a year in the month of,
- June
- December
This periodic review will ensures that the index remains updated and relevant and reflects the changes in the market dynamics and company performance.
